Official: Dele Adeleye Pens Three - Year Deal With Kuban Krasnodar
Published: February 21, 2013
Through a statement on the official website, Russian Premier League club FC Kuban Krasnodar have announced the acquisition of Nigeria international defender Dele Adeleye on a three - year contract.
Adeleye, who was a member of the Super Eagles squad at the 2010 World Cup, impressed coach Leonid Kuchuk during tests and has been rewarded with a deal which keeps him in Southern Russia until 2016.
Recall that the 24 - year - old central defender unilaterally terminated his contract with Ukrainian club Tavriya citing breach of contract.
He had not played an official game since July 2012. Hence, it was logical for him to undergo trials with Kuban before being offered a contract.
Dele Adeleye previously defended the colors of Shooting Stars, Sparta Rotterdam and Metalurh Donetsk in addition to his stint with Tavriya.
